On 18/11/2020 09.51, Cornelia Huck wrote: > The zPCI group and function structures are big endian. However, we do > not consistently store them as big endian locally, and are missing some > conversions. > > Let's just store the structures as host endian instead and convert to > big endian when actually handling the instructions retrieving the data. > > Also fix the layout of ClpReqQueryPciGrp: g is actually only 8 bit. This > also fixes accesses on little endian hosts. > > Fixes: 28dc86a07299 ("s390x/pci: use a PCI Group structure") > Fixes: 9670ee752727 ("s390x/pci: use a PCI Function structure") > Fixes: 1e7552ff5c34 ("s390x/pci: get zPCI function info from host") > Signed-off-by: Cornelia Huck <coh...@redhat.com> > --- > > Alternative approach to my patch from yesterday. The change is bigger, > but the end result is arguably nicer.
